The Loch Raven Business Association (LRBA):
  • Was established by area business owners and managers in 1994.
  • Represents member businesses through advocacy to government officials, cooperative actions with community and promotional activities.
  • Focuses on improving the area inside the Beltway (North) City Line (South) Perring Parkway (East) Goucher Blvd. (West).

LRBA has established close ties with the Loch Raven residential communities, organizations and institutions that have resulted in a powerful coalition of interested citizens that speaks loudly in support of the Loch Raven area.

LRBA pursues publicity and promotions to increase awareness of the products and services of our members and to enhance the spirit of community in the entire Loch Raven area.

  • Partnered in 1996 with the Loch Raven Kiwanis and the Loch Raven Community Council to sponsor the annual Fourth of July fireworks and community picnic.
  • Partnered in June 1998 with the seventeen Loch Raven area community associations, schools, churches and other organizations for the Celebration of Loch Raven" in conjunction with the Loch Raven Library reopening.
  • Distributes promotional materials from member businesses to community associations in welcome bags for new residents of Loch Raven.
  • Coordinates Santa visits to members and community events.
  • Actively supports the Police Athletic League, the Library. neighborhood projects and Neighborhood Housing Services of Greater Hillendale.

LRBA acts as a catalyst to obtain public improvements, encourage private investment and stimulate economic growth.

  • Initiated the Loch Raven Corridor Enhancement Project scheduled to bring $5 Million of improvements in pedestrian friendly walkways, streetscaping. lighting and roadway.
  • LRBA spearheaded the effort to establish Loch Raven as one of the twelve designated Commercial Revitalization Districts in Baltimore County to bring the benefits of:
  • Architectural design assistance
  • Business improvement loans with 3% interest rates for exterior and property improvements
  • Small Business Loans with below market rates for real estate. Fixed asset and working capital
  • Commercial Revitalization Tax Credit allows property tax credit against increased real property taxes that result from physical improvements
  • The Neighborhood Business Development Program provides gap financing for predevelopment, development and start up operating costs.
